Uryupinsk experiences a continental climate, characterized by distinct seasons and significant temperature variations. Summers are generally warm, while winters can be quite cold. The region is also known for its low precipitation levels, resulting in relatively dry conditions throughout the year.Seasonal Temperatures
The following table provides a comprehensive overview of the average monthly temperatures in Uryupinsk:Month | Average High (°C) | Average Low (°C) |
---|---|---|
January | -7.0 | -13.6 |
February | -5.6 | -12.9 |
March | 0.2 | -7.4 |
April | 10.4 | 0.4 |
May | 18.3 | 7.3 |
June | 23.2 | 12.0 |
July | 26.0 | 14.3 |
August | 25.1 | 13.4 |
September | 19.1 | 8.2 |
October | 10.7 | 1.9 |
November | 1.5 | -6.1 |
December | -4.4 | -11.6 |
As seen from the table, temperatures in Uryupinsk range from mild to extremely cold throughout the year. The hottest months are July and August, with average highs of 26.0°C. Conversely, the coldest months are January and February, with average lows of -13.6°C and -12.9°C respectively. It is important to note that temperatures can occasionally drop even lower during particularly cold winters.
Precipitation and Sunshine
Uryupinsk has a relatively dry climate, with low levels of precipitation and a significant amount of sunshine throughout the year. The following table provides an overview of the average monthly precipitation and sunshine hours in Uryupinsk:Month | Precipitation (mm) | Sunshine Hours |
---|---|---|
January | 17 | 67 |
February | 14 | 90 |
March | 18 | 142 |
April | 25 | 204 |
May | 33 | 285 |
June | 36 | 305 |
July | 30 | 322 |
August | 28 | 277 |
September | 23 | 210 |
October | 22 | 141 |
November | 24 | 66 |
December | 19 | 42 |
From the table, it is evident that precipitation levels are relatively low throughout the year in Uryupinsk, with the highest levels occurring in the months of May and June. Sunshine hours are generally abundant, with the highest number of hours recorded in June. This makes Uryupinsk an ideal destination for those who enjoy outdoor activities and sunny weather.
Extreme Weather Events
While Uryupinsk experiences a generally stable climate, it is not immune to extreme weather events. The most notable of these events are blizzards and heavy snowfall during the winter months. These can lead to travel disruptions and difficult road conditions. It is advisable to check weather forecasts and road conditions before planning a visit during the winter season.Conclusion
